# Resume Customizer Skill
This skill provides comprehensive resume customization capabilities to match job descriptions (JD). It supports multiple input/output formats and provides ATS optimization.
## When to Use This Skill
This skill should be used when the user wants to:
- Customize an existing resume to match a specific job description
- Generate a new resume based on a JD and user background
- Optimize a resume for ATS (Applicant Tracking System) systems
- Extract and match skills between a resume and JD
- Convert a resume between different formats (PDF, Word, Markdown, HTML, text)

## Core Workflow
### Step 1: Parse Inputs
1. **Parse Resume** (if provided):
- Use `scripts/parse_resume.py` to extract structured data from the resume
- Supported formats: PDF, Word, text, Markdown
- Extract: contact info, summary, work experience, education, skills, projects, certifications
2. **Parse JD**:
- Use `scripts/parse_jd.py` to extract structured data from the job description
- Supported inputs: text, URL, PDF, Word, Markdown
- Extract: job title, company, required skills, preferred skills, responsibilities, qualifications, keywords
### Step 2: Analysis and Matching
1. **Skill Matching**:
- Compare skills in resume vs JD
- Identify matching skills, missing skills, and additional skills
- Use `references/industry_keywords.json` for comprehensive keyword coverage
2. **Keyword Extraction**:
- Extract important keywords from JD (required qualifications, preferred qualifications, responsibilities)
- Identify ATS-relevant keywords
- Use `references/ats_optimization.md` for ATS best practices
3. **Gap Analysis**:
- Identify gaps between resume and JD
- Suggest improvements to address gaps
- Prioritize improvements based on JD requirements
### Step 3: Customization
1. **Tailor Resume Content**:
- Reorder sections based on JD priorities
- Highlight matching skills and experiences
- Adjust summary/objective to align with JD
- Quantify achievements relevant to the position
- Use action verbs from `references/best_practices.md`
2. **Keyword Optimization**:
- Naturally incorporate JD keywords into resume
- Ensure keyword density is appropriate for ATS systems
- Use synonyms and related terms to avoid keyword stuffing
- Follow guidelines in `references/ats_optimization.md`
3. **Format Optimization**:
- Ensure ATS-friendly formatting (simple layout, standard section headings)
- Remove graphics, tables, and special characters that may confuse ATS
- Use standard fonts and formatting
### Step 4: Generate Output
1. **Select Output Format**:
- Ask user for preferred output format (default: same as input format)
- Use `scripts/export_resume.py` to generate the output
2. **Apply Template** (optional):
- Use templates from `assets/templates/` for professional formatting
- Available templates: standard (English), standard-zh (Chinese), modern, professional
3. **Generate Output**:
- Create the resume in the specified format
- Ensure all customizations are applied
- Validate the output for completeness

### ATS Optimization
Follow the guidelines in `references/ats_optimization.md`:
- Use standard section headings (Work Experience, Education, Skills, etc.)
- Avoid headers/footers, tables, text boxes, graphics
- Use standard fonts (Arial, Calibri, Times New Roman)
- Include keywords from JD naturally
- Save as .docx or .pdf (text-based PDF, not scanned)

## Multi-Language Support
This skill supports both Chinese (中文) and English resumes:
### Chinese Resumes:
- Use `standard-zh.json` template
- Follow Chinese resume conventions (photo optional, age/gender not required)
- Use Chinese keywords from `industry_keywords.json`
- Output formats: .docx (with Chinese fonts), .pdf (embed fonts)
### English Resumes:
- Use `standard-en.json` template
- Follow Western resume conventions (no photo, no personal info beyond contact)
- Use English keywords from `industry_keywords.json`
- Output formats: all supported formats

## Important Notes
1. **Privacy**: Always handle user resumes and personal data with strict confidentiality
2. **Accuracy**: Do not invent or fabricate experiences not present in the original resume
3. **Honesty**: Optimize and tailor content, but never misrepresent qualifications
4. **User Review**: Always have the user review customized resumes before submitting to employers
5. **Backup**: Keep original resume files and provide both original and customized versions to the user

## Customization Checklist
Before delivering the customized resume, ensure:
- [ ] All JD-required skills present (or addressed in cover letter)
- [ ] Keywords from JD incorporated naturally
- [ ] Achievements quantified where possible
- [ ] Action verbs used throughout
- [ ] Formatting is ATS-friendly
- [ ] Contact information is current and professional
- [ ] Spelling and grammar checked
- [ ] Length appropriate for experience level
- [ ] User has reviewed and approved all changes
